1. Introduction to Singapore’s Accommodation Scene

Planning a trip to Singapore means picking the right place to stay. You can choose from Luxury Resorts Singapore to Budget-Friendly Lodging Singapore. This way, you find something that fits your needs and budget.

Singapore has many places to stay, like five-star hotels and cozy hostels. You can pick from Marina Bay, Civic District, and Chinatown. Each area has its own charm and things to see.

Singapore Accommodation Options

  • Marina Bay: known for its luxury hotels and iconic attractions
  • Civic District: offers more affordable five-star hotels and easy access to cultural and historical attractions
  • Chinatown: provides budget-friendly accommodations and a blend of historic temples and modern amenities

Choosing the right place to stay in Singapore can make your trip better. It lets you enjoy the city more.

2. Luxury Hotels in Singapore

Singapore is known for its luxury accommodations. It’s one of the wealthiest countries, offering top-notch hotels. You can find everything from the famous Marina Bay Sands to the stylish Mandarin Oriental.

The best hotels in Singapore include the Raffles Singapore and the Shangri-La Singapore. They have amazing amenities like spas and water parks. For those looking for something more affordable, the Ann Siang House and the Warehouse Hotel are great choices.

For a luxurious stay, check out the luxury resorts Singapore has. The Capella Singapore is huge, with 30 acres and 112 rooms. The Mondrian Singapore Duxton has 302 keys and offers many upscale amenities. With prices starting at $191, now is a great time to enjoy Singapore’s luxury hotels.

Luxury Resorts Singapore

  • The Singapore EDITION
  • Como Metropolitan Singapore
  • Raffles Singapore
  • Shangri-La Singapore
  • The Fullerton Hotel Singapore

These hotels provide top services and amenities. They’re ideal for anyone seeking a luxurious stay in Singapore.

3. Boutique Hotels: A Personalized Experience

Boutique hotels in Singapore offer a special and personalized stay. They focus on local culture and heritage. This makes them a great choice for those on a budget, as they provide quality at a good price.

The Warehouse Hotel is a great example, blending old and new. The Clan Hotel welcomes guests with a special tea. The Barracks Hotel Sentosa mixes old charm with modern comforts. Naumi Singapore has a rooftop pool with amazing views.

For the best stay in Singapore, consider these places:

  • The Sultan, with its 60 unique guestrooms within historical shophouses
  • Hotel Soloha, offering a vibrant atmosphere with a focus on style and high-end products
  • Lloyd’s Inn, featuring 34 rooms and a rooftop terrace and communal outdoor pantry

4. Budget-Friendly Options

Looking for Affordable Accommodation Singapore? You have many choices. From hostels to budget hotels, these places are great for meeting others. Hotel Boss, Ibis Budget Singapore Clarke Quay, and Hotel 81 – Chinatown are some top picks. They start at SGD 100, SGD 120, and SGD 80 per night.

These options are not just cheap. They’re also in great locations, near attractions and public transport. For instance, V Hotel Lavender is right next to the Lavender MRT Station. Holiday Inn Express Singapore Katong is just a 15-minute drive from downtown. So, finding the right Budget-Friendly Lodging Singapore is easy.

What makes these places special? Here are some key features:

  • Free Wi-Fi
  • Breakfast options
  • Access to swimming pools
  • Proximity to MRT stations and major attractions

5. Family-Friendly Accommodation

In Singapore, many places are great for families, including Luxury Resorts Singapore with fun kids’ areas. The Best Hotels in Singapore for families are easy to find. They’re near MRT stations or fun spots.

The Village Hotel Bugis is close to Bugis MRT, just a 3-minute walk. The Park Hotel on Beach Road is about 550 meters from an MRT. The Fort Canning Lodge is near three MRT stations, making it easy for families to get around.

For meals, families can try Hawker Centres for under $20 USD on different nights. This is a budget-friendly choice. Many hotels also have special packages, like the Grand Hyatt Singapore’s package for $953 per night for four. The Pullman Singapore Hill Street has a package for $375++ per night for two adults and a child.

6. Themed Hotels: Something Different

Many travelers in Singapore seek a unique stay. Themed hotels offer a memorable experience. They range from luxury to budget-friendly, catering to all tastes.

The Bus Collective features 20 rooms from repurposed buses. The Warehouse Hotel keeps its 1895 construction features. These hotels stand out with their unique charm.

Hotel Indigo Singapore Katong is perfect for couples, with a rooftop pool and views. Equarius TreeTop Lofts lets you stay in nature, elevated.

Here are some key features of themed hotels in Singapore:

  • Unique themes and concepts, such as bus-themed or warehouse-themed hotels
  • Luxury amenities, including rooftop pools and fine dining restaurants
  • Budget-friendly options, such as capsule hotels and hostels
  • Romantic getaways, including hotels with private jacuzzis and stunning views

7. Exploring Cultural Districts and Neighborhoods

As I explore Singapore, I find a mix of old and new. It’s a unique place. When looking for places to stay, I check out cultural areas and neighborhoods. They offer many choices, from fancy hotels to affordable stays.

Neighborhoods like Chinatown, Little India, and Kampong Glam are great. They’re full of life, with traditional shops and food. For example, Chinatown has the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ple. Little India is known for its colorful temples and street art.

Other areas, like Orchard Road and Marina Bay, are also worth visiting. Orchard Road is great for shopping and fun. Marina Bay has amazing views of the city. Singapore has many places to stay, from luxury to cozy, to fit any budget.

Some popular places to stay in Singapore include:

  • Chinatown: known for its traditional shops and restaurants
  • Little India: famous for its colorful temples and street art
  • Kampong Glam: a historic neighborhood with a mix of Malay and Arab influences
  • Orchard Road: a popular shopping and entertainment district
  • Marina Bay: offers stunning views of the city skyline

9. Short-Term Rentals: A Home Away from Home

Many travelers choose short-term rentals in Singapore for a home-like experience. These rentals come in various sizes, from cozy studios to large apartments. They offer comfort and flexibility, making them a top choice for many.

Orchard apartments are a favorite, with an average rating of 4.67 from 498 reviews. The Two-Bedroom Executive Pan Pacific Serviced Suites even got a perfect score of 5. These places have great amenities like fully equipped kitchens and private balconies.

Short-term rentals offer a unique and memorable stay. You can find everything from affordable studios to luxurious penthouses. They’re perfect for romantic getaways or family vacations, providing a home away from home.

10. Experiencing the Nightlife: Best Areas to Stay

Singapore is a top spot for nightlife, with many areas to explore. It’s an Entertainment Hub with everything from rooftop bars to clubs. There’s something for everyone.

Looking for Affordable Accommodation Singapore? Little India and Chinatown have many budget-friendly options. For example, the YOTEL in Orchard Road starts at $90 per night. On the other hand, Marina Bay and Sentosa offer luxury for a higher price.

Here are some top areas for nightlife:

  • Clarke Quay: known for its vibrant atmosphere and dining options
  • Orchard Road: a popular destination for shopping and entertainment
  • Marina Bay: home to the famous Marina Bay Sands and a range of luxury hotels

For Budget-Friendly Lodging Singapore, try Bugis Village or Haji Lane. They have many affordable options. Or, look for Best Hotels in Singapore like the Capitol Kempinski in the Colonial District.

The best area for you depends on what you like and your budget. With so many choices, you’ll find the perfect spot for Singapore’s nightlife.

Area Accommodation Options Price Range
Marina Bay Luxury hotels $600-$1,000 per night
Orchard Road Mix of luxury and budget-friendly options $90-$500 per night
Little India Budget-friendly hotels and hostels $30-$100 per night
